What is the image of concave mirror?
Concave mirrors form both real and virtual images. When the concave mirror is placed very close to the object, a virtual and magnified image is obtained and if we increase the distance between the object and the mirror, the size of the image reduces and real images are formed.

What is the image in a convex mirror?
The image formed in a convex mirror is always virtual and erect, whatever be the position of the object.
How do you draw a concave ray diagram?
Step-by-Step Method for Drawing Ray Diagrams
- Pick a point on the top of the object and draw two incident rays traveling towards the mirror.
- Once these incident rays strike the mirror, reflect them according to the two rules of reflection for concave mirrors.
- Mark the image of the top of the object.

What is the position of image in concave lens?
(a) In the case of a concave lens, when an object is placed anywhere between the optical centre and infinity, then the position of the image is between the optical centre and the focus, nature of the image is virtual and erect and size is diminished.
